Full Description
This book offers a comprehensive introduction to electrochemistry and its applications in electroanalysis. It begins by establishing the fundamental principles before guiding readers through the most widely used electroanalytical techniques, their practical applications, and methods for reliable data analysis. Sensor design and fabrication are explored in detail, including essential equipment such as potentiostats, electrodes, and electrochemical cells, along with key considerations for experiments conducted in the laboratory, with real samples, or on site.The book also examines a broad range of analytes, from heavy metals and environmental contaminants to healthcare-related targets, highlighting their importance, regulatory limits, and representative electroanalytical outputs. A dedicated chapter on biosensors introduces their components, fabrication strategies, and examples from current research.Looking toward the future of the field, the book explores the rapidly expanding role of additive manufacturing and 3D printing in creating bespoke electrochemical sensors. It concludes with an overview of wearable electroanalytical technologies, discussing strategies for sensor integration and the challenges of adapting devices for use on different parts of the body.
